CourseDetails
โข Advanced Historical Analysis: Understanding the history and cultural significance of heritage sites is crucial to their conservation. This unit will delve into sophisticated historical research methods and interpretation techniques.
โข Legal Frameworks in Heritage Conservation: This unit will explore national and international laws, policies, and conventions that govern heritage conservation. It will also cover the legal aspects of heritage designation and protection.
โข Conservation Science and Technology: This unit will discuss the latest scientific methods and technologies used in heritage conservation, including material analysis, digital documentation, and sustainable materials.
โข Heritage Planning and Development: This unit will cover strategic planning for heritage conservation, including urban planning, heritage district development, and public engagement strategies.
โข Risk Management in Heritage Conservation: This unit will explore potential risks to heritage sites, such as natural disasters, human activities, and climate change, and strategies for managing these risks.
โข Conservation Project Management: This unit will provide students with the skills to manage heritage conservation projects, including budgeting, scheduling, and stakeholder communication.
โข Cultural Landscape Conservation: This unit will focus on the conservation of cultural landscapes, including rural landscapes, historic gardens, and indigenous landscapes.
โข Sustainable Tourism and Heritage Conservation: This unit will discuss the role of sustainable tourism in heritage conservation, including the benefits and challenges of tourism at heritage sites.
โข Public Engagement and Advocacy: This unit will cover strategies for engaging the public in heritage conservation, including education, outreach, and advocacy.
